Thailand Forum to Discuss Role of Faith Leaders in Establishing World Peace

10:19 - February 09, 2025
News ID: 3491797
IQNA – The Iranian Cultural Attaché in Thailand during a meeting with officials of Chulalongkorn University talked about holding the third edition of a religions forum.

The Iranian Cultural Attaché in Thailand held a meeting with officials of Chulalongkorn University

 

The theme of the third edition will be “role of religious leaders in establishing world peace”.

Officials of Chulalongkorn University’s Center for Asian Studies and Islamic Research were also present at the meeting.

The Iranian cultural envoy, Mehdi Zare Bieyb, underlined the importance of interfaith dialogue in strengthening world peace and hailed the selection of the university as the next host of the forum.

He said the series of forums are aimed at promoting peace in the world and enhancing peaceful coexistence in different societies.

He noted that Iran hosted the first edition, which features a broad range of topics related to challenges and opportunities for interaction among faiths in the contemporary era.

Zare Bieyb added that the second edition was held in Thailand focusing on the successful models of religious coexistence in Asia and role of religious leaders in reducing cultural and social tensions.

He said holding the third edition at Chulalongkorn University can provide an opportunity for researchers and faith leaders to come up with new strategies for world peace and create a network of religious thinkers and elites at the international level.

In addition to its scientific aspects, the forum can contribute to the development of sustainable collaborations between Iranian and Thai universities in various fields, including comparative religious studies, regional studies, and academic exchange programs, he stated.

“It is suggested that in the future, a series of joint conferences and workshops be held between the two countries to institutionalize these collaborations in the long term.”

During the meeting, the officials of Chulalongkorn University expressed readiness to facilitate the organizing the forum and using online platforms to attract broader participation of academics from all over the world.

They stressed that Islamic and Asian studies play an important role in better understanding cultures, and hoped the forum can provide a suitable platform for sustainable and effective collaboration among universities.
